I met lots of Scooby owners tonight over the West Yorkshire area, some fantastic looking cars, and a great set of lads with passion for there motors.

I myself have a works.....Cooper S Works!!! I run and organise various Mini-Runs in and around Yorkshire, I try to pick the very best roads free from clutter and traffic.

My next run on the calender is the Heartbeat Run on the 4th June 2006.
I'd like to offer any Scooby owner the chance to join well over 50+ Mini's, for a run which will always be remembered

Some excellent roads for drivers with all abilities, fast long straights, twisty hill climbs, breath taking views.
It covers just over 147 miles of perfect North Yorkshire countryside

Start time 10am in Thirsk, at the Tesco Car Park
